President Lee Departs for State Visit to France, Co-Chairs 'Lumiere Summit'

President Lee Jae-myung, accompanied by First Lady Kim Hye-kyung, departed for France this morning (the 6th) from Seoul Air Base for a state visit at the invitation of French President Emmanuel Macron.

On the first day, President Lee will attend the Lumiere Summit, an international film and visual content summit held in Saint-Paul-de-Vence in southern France, in the capacity of co-chair.

He will then travel to Paris to hold a private luncheon and a summit meeting with President Macron, during which they plan to discuss ways to expand cooperation in advanced technology fields such as artificial intelligence and nuclear energy.
